Baylor Bears vs Marquette Golden Eagles Preview and Analysis

 
Baylor is coming into this game with a 5-1 record overall and they are 0-0 in their road games this season where they will be in this game. They are entering this game on a 2 game winning streak with wins coming against the UCLA Bruins and the McNeese State Cowboys in their last game. Keyonte George led the team in points in that game with 17 while LJ Cryer was next on the team with 16 points. Dale Bonner led the team in assists in that game with 12 while Jalen Bridges led the team in rebounds with 7. They were 56.7% from the field, 40% from 3-point range, and 52.9% from the free throw line with their shooting in that game. Their offense is averaging 91.2 PPG and their defense is allowing their opponents to average 67.7 PPG against them. Baylor has an ATS record of 3-3 this season and their O/U record is 5-1.
 
 
Marquette is coming into this game with a 5-2 record overall and they are 4-0 in their home games this season where they will be in this game. They are entering this game on a 2 game winning streak with wins coming against the Georgia Tech Yellow Jackets and the Chicago State Cougars in their last game. Olivier-Maxence Prosper led the team in points in that game with 18 while Kameron Jones was next on the team with 15 points. Tyler Kolek led the team in assists in that game with 8 while Olivier-Maxence Prosper led the team in rebounds with 11. They were 50.9% from the field, 30% from 3-point range, and 60% from the free throw line with their shots in that game. Their offense is averaging 80.3 PPG and their defense is allowing their opponents to average 65.9 PPG against them. Marquette has an ATS record of 4-2-1 this season and their O/U record is 3-4.

 

Baylor vs Marquette Prediction

The current betting odds have Marquette listed as a 5 point underdog in this game according to Draftkings Sportsbook. Marquette has looked good in a lot of their games this season, they are only 5-2 this year but have some big blowout wins under their belt along with some really close losses to some really good teams like their 5 point loss to Purdue which was not at home. Now Marquette will be at home in this game where they have a very good home advantage and they are going to bring their best effort for one of the best teams in the country here. Baylor has also looked really good in their games this year since most of their wins have been big blowout wins, but they do have a loss to Virginia and have shown their cracks against good defensive teams. Marquette is going to be all over Baylor on their home court here and they will try to disrupt their shooting as much as possible to keep this game within their reach. They were a really good team last season under Shaka Smart and they are only going to get better in his 2nd season here. Marquette will fight all night to keep this a close game and might even pull off the upset at home. The best way to place a bet here is on Marquette to cover the spread in this game.
 
Baylor Marquette Prediction:  Our NCAAB Pick for Tuesday, November 29, 2022 (8:30 pm ET start time) is Marquette 72 Baylor 71.
